Title
What Happens When Myopia Control Stops? A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is of Myopia Progression after Cessation of Atropine
Review Question
What are the consequences of discontinuing atropine-based myopia control treatment, regardless of the reason, such as atropine, or combination therapies involving atropine.
Study Type Included
Randomized controlled trials(RCTs), Pseudo-RCTs, cohort and case-control studies.
Condition Being Studied
Myopia represents a significant and escalating public health issue, particularly in East Asia, where it has reached a pandemic level. By the year 2020, approximately 2.5 billion individuals are projected to be impacted by myopia. While various treatment methods have shown effectiveness, the presence of a rebound effect following therapy raises concerns about the true benefits of each treatment approach.
Participant
Inclusion criteria: - Studies with data associated with axial length or refractive error measurement - Studies enrolled participants with myopia who received the atropine-based myopia treatment for at least six months and then ceased the intervention more than 1 month - Patients who discontinue myopia control treatments, regardless of the reason, with no restriction to the age Exclusion criteria: - Case report, case series - Studies that involved participants with congenital or severe ophthalmological conditions or surgical history that may influence the outcome - Studies with overlapping participants
Animal
Human Disease Modelled
Intervention
Topical atropine or combination therapy involving atropine
Comparator Control
Placebo or non-myopia control devices such as spectacles or single vision contact lenses will be incorporated for comparative analysis
Main Outcome
Axial length Spherical equivalent Adherence and reasons of cessation Measures of effect After cessation 6 months, 12 months, 24 months, 36 months
